Visit Jeonju Gyeonggijeon Shrine. The Gyeonggijeon Shrine is located just outside the hanok village. Gyeonggjieon is one of the best things to see in Jeonju! This Shrine was built at the very beginning of the 15th century, a few years after the death of King Taejo, founder of the Joseon dynasty.

Jeonju is the 16th largest city in South Korea and the capital of North Jeolla Province. It is both urban and rural due to the closeness of Wanju County which almost entirely surrounds Jeonju (Wanju County has many residents who work in Jeonju). Web26 mag 2024 · 1. Jeonju Hanok Village. Designated as an International Slow City in 2010, Jeonju Hanok Village (전주한옥마을) is the top attraction to visit in Jeonju. Escape from the bustle and hustle of stressful city life in Jeonju Hanok Village, which is home to over 800 Korean traditional houses where people still live.
